Wax supplier

A wax supplier is a business that specializes in the distribution and sale of wax. This can include a variety of different types of wax, such as paraffin wax, beeswax, soy wax, and more. These businesses typically sell their products in bulk quantities, making them a wholesale operation.

Wholesale refers to the sale of goods in large quantities, typically to be resold by other businesses. Wholesalers are often able to offer lower prices due to the high volume of their sales.

Raw materials are the basic
materials that are used to produce goods. In the case of a wax supplier, the raw material would be the different types of wax that they sell. These can be used in a variety of applications, including candle making, cosmetics, food production, and more.

Wax is a broad term that can refer to a variety of different substances. In general, wax is a fatty, solid substance that melts easily. It can be derived from a variety of sources, including petroleum (paraffin wax), plants (soy wax), and animals (beeswax). Each type of wax has its own unique properties and uses.

Based on the provided documentation and focusing on a wax supplier business operating in the wholesale and raw materials sector, there are several impactful automations that can streamline operations, increase efficiency, and reduce manual workload. Here are the key automations that a business of this profile should prioritize:

---

1. Order Processing and Management Automation

- Automate the intake of wholesale orders via multiple channels (online forms, email, B2B portals) into a centralized order management system.
- Automated order confirmations: Instantly send email confirmations and invoices upon order receipt.
- Order status updates: Automatically notify customers about order progress, shipping status, or delivery through email or SMS.

---

2. Inventory Management

- Real-time inventory updates: Synchronize stock levels across sales channels and warehouses automatically to prevent overselling and stockouts.
- Low-stock alerts and auto-reordering: Set triggers when inventory hits a threshold for automatic supplier or production reordering.
- Raw material tracking: Automate batch tracking and raw material consumption to comply with quality and traceability requirements.

---

3. Supplier and Procurement Automation

- Automated purchase orders: Generate and send purchase orders to suppliers as soon as inventory levels require replenishment.
- Invoice matching and approval: Match invoices to POs and delivery records automatically, routing discrepancies for review and reducing manual checking.

---

4. Customer Relationship and Account Management

- Wholesale client onboarding: Automate the onboarding of new wholesale clients, including account creation, credit vetting, and document gathering.
- Automated reminders: Send due payment reminders, contract renewals, and account status updates on a schedule.

---

5. Shipping and Logistics Automation

- Shipping label generation: Automatically create and print shipping labels based on order details.
- Carrier selection and tracking: Pick optimal shipping carriers and share tracking details with clients automatically.
- Customs documentation: For international shipments, automate customs documentation preparation.

---

6. Compliance and Quality Control

- Automated documentation: Generate safety data sheets, compliance certificates and batch traceability reports.
- Incident tracking: Automatically log and escalate quality incidents or non-conformities for resolution.

---

7. Financial and Accounting Automations

- Automated invoicing: Create and send invoices as soon as an order is fulfilled.
- Payment reconciliation: Match incoming payments to outstanding invoices, flagging discrepancies or overdue accounts.
- Reporting: Schedule automated sales, inventory, and financial reports for management.

---

8. Marketing and Customer Engagement

- Email newsletters: Automate periodic updates, product launches, and promotions to wholesale clients.
- Customer feedback gathering: Trigger review request emails or satisfaction surveys after order completion.

---

9. Document Management and Workflow Automation

- Centralized file storage automation: Sync contracts, invoices, and certificates from emails and forms to cloud storage, organized by client or deal.
- Approvals routing: Automate workflow for key approvals, such as discounts, credit limits, or large purchases.

---
